Can you add a gas fireplace to an existing house?

Yes, we can add a gas fireplace to your existing Oregon home. Many older homes in Portland can be updated with a gas insert. This is a popular way to add warmth and style. We assess your home to ensure a safe and efficient installation.

Is it worth installing a gas fireplace?

For Oregon homeowners, a gas fireplace is often worth it. It provides convenient, clean heat. It also enhances the ambiance of your living space. Many find it adds significant value to their property. Enjoy instant warmth on chilly Portland evenings.

Do you need a permit to install a gas fireplace insert?

Permit requirements can vary in Oregon. Some installations, especially those involving gas lines or venting changes, may require a permit. We help you understand these local rules. Ensuring compliance keeps your installation safe and legal.
